Average Power Plant Operators Salary in Portland-South Portland, ME

The average salary for Power Plant Operatorss in Portland-South Portland, ME is $83,620. While this is lower than the national average, the cost of living in Portland-South Portland, ME may offset the difference, preserving real purchasing power.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$83,620 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 0.0%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$114,460.
  • Outlook: The current demand for Power Plant Operatorss is stable, with a local workforce of approximately 40 professionals. This role remains a specialized component of the broader Portland-South Portland, ME economy.

Power Plant Operators Salary Distribution in Portland-South Portland, ME

The earning potential for Power Plant Operatorss in Portland-South Portland, ME varies significantly by experience level. The salary gap is relatively narrow, suggesting consistent and predictable earnings from entry-level to senior positions. Entry-level roles (10th percentile) typically start around $60,970, while highly experienced professionals can command wages upwards of $114,460.

Job Market Context

40

Total Jobs

0.132

Per 1K Jobs

0.66

Location Quotient

Below Average

Portland-South Portland, ME has 0.66x the national average concentration of Power Plant Operators jobs. This means there are fewer opportunities per capita here compared to the U.S. average — competition for roles may be higher.

40 people work as Power Plant Operators in Portland-South Portland, ME.

Only 0.132 out of every 1,000 local jobs are Power Plant Operators roles — this is a niche profession in the area.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does a Power Plant Operators make in Portland-South Portland, ME?

The median annual salary for a Power Plant Operators in Portland-South Portland, ME is $83,620. This typically ranges from $60,970 for entry-level positions to $114,460 for top-level roles.

How does the salary compare to the national average?

The average salary for this role in Portland-South Portland, ME is 14.4% lower than the national median of $97,730.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 40 employees in the Portland-South Portland, ME area with a job density of 0.132 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
